In the Esports Swamp, You are Only Someone’s Plaything
Counter Logic Gaming is dead. Team SoloMid is pausing its Esports endeavors after suffering massive losses from the fall of disgraced cryptocurrency exchange FTX, which had brokered a lucrative $210 million naming partnership. Activision-Blizzard’s Overwatch League is continuing its freefall into a full-fledged fiasco. Riot Games’ League Championship Series is experiencing a significant decline in…
